autocad 2015 Freeze on every modify command

anyone can help me please. 

with i7 3.4 gHz 16gb ram 

graphic card quadro 4000

autocad 2015 freeze on every modify command. expecially when I work on 3D drawing. ..The only way out from the freeze is control+alt+del

It s been long time to find the problem....but till now there is no solution.

Hello

 

Sorry I haven't too much time to study your DWG ...

 

But I admit that there is a probleme with this blue object !

Maybe coming from a vertical ACAD (AA, MEP, etc) or from other CAD program ?

 

So with EXPORT (ACIS format) then IMPORT (ACIS Format), you will get a clean (ex Blue) 3D Object !
